Redefining Stereotypes in Literature

The chapter explores the adaptation of a novel tackling stereotypes in the publishing industry post-Black Lives Matter, drawing parallels to Mark Twain's Huck Finn and discussing the motivation behind rewriting the narrative for a more comprehensive portrayal of the characters.
